In order to strengthen investment in people, Prime Minister Kishida has announced that he will invest 400 billion yen in measures to support workers over a three-year period so that they can acquire skills in a new era such as digital.

On the night of the 12th, Prime Minister Kishida exchanged opinions with business owners of companies that are active in human resource development and operational efficiency in Tokyo, and listened to their efforts to pass on technology using digital technology.



After this, Prime Minister Kishida told reporters 400 billion to implement a "three-year policy package" to help workers who announced the formulation to acquire skills of a new era such as digital. Clarified the idea of ​​throwing a yen.



On top of that, "The government does not unilaterally decide the contents of the package, but wants to solicit ideas widely from private companies and individuals and decide the content. Use the package for everyone, including non-regular people and women who have finished raising children. I want them to get concrete results. "
